20250804812The Vice-Dean's Office for Educational Affairs and Development through the Alumni Unit, in collaboration with the Department of Computer and Information Science, organized a workshop titled “How to deal with supervisors in the workplace.”
The workshop was delivered by Dr. Sarah Al-Jak and focused on effective workplace relationships as a key factor in professional success and stability. It highlighted the importance of building a positive relationship between employees and their direct supervisors, based on mutual respect, adherence to policies, and understanding different management styles to ensure clear and effective communication.
The session also discussed essential practices such as punctuality, completing tasks accurately and on time, and maintaining clear and professional communication. Participants were encouraged to present ideas and questions respectfully, avoid unproductive arguments, and address differences of opinion objectively, supported by facts and a focus on achieving shared goals.
The workshop emphasized that supervisors aim to improve work quality and achieve organizational objectives. Demonstrating a willingness to learn and take responsibility reflects professional maturity and enhances career growth opportunities. At the same time, maintaining professional boundaries and avoiding overly personal interactions were highlighted as important for a healthy work environment.
The workshop concluded with an interactive Q&A session, allowing students to engage and clarify key points.
